Controller's Operations
Provides strategic leadership and oversight of the University's accounting and controllership functions to ensure accurate financial reporting, strong internal controls, regulatory compliance, and sound fiscal stewardship. Directs the University's core accounting operations, including financial reporting, general accounting, capital improvements, treasury, payroll, fixed assets, accounts payable, foundation, and student accounts, while serving as a trusted advisor to University leadership on accounting and financial matters.
Controller'sOperations:
Financial Leadership
- Direct the University's accounting and controllership functions, including General Accounting, Payroll, Accounts Payable, Student Accounts, and Foundation related support
- Lead month-end and year-end close processes to ensure timely, accurate financial reporting
- Ensure compliance with GAAP, GASB pronouncements, state and federal regulations, and University policies
- Serve as key liaison with University of Louisiana System in close coordination with Vice President of Finance
- Lead preparation of the University's Annual Financial Report (AFR) and other required federal, state, NCAA, Board of Regents, SACSCOC, and IPEDS reporting
- Provide executive leadership with timely financial analysis, dashboards, and decision-support reporting
- Interpret accounting standards and recommend implementation strategies
- Coordinate all external financial audits and serve as the University's primary accounting liaison with auditors
- Lead responses to audit findings and oversee implementation of corrective actions
- Maintain a comprehensive system of internal controls and risk management practices
- Champion continuous improvement initiatives by leveraging Banner ERP, automation, workflow enhancements, and emerging technologies to improve efficiency, strengthen controls, and enhance financial reporting

Minimum:
- Bachelor's degree in Finance, Accounting, Business, or related field
- Five years of progressively responsible accounting or finance leadership
- Supervisory experience leading professional accounting staff
- Strong knowledge of GAAP and governmental accounting principles
- Excellent analytical, communication, leadership skills
Preferred:
- CPA strongly preferred
- MBA or other related advanced degree
- Higher education accounting experience
- 3-5 years of Banner ERP experience
- Experience with GASB reporting
- Experience leading financial audit
